Toe Up Larch Peds
These toe-up beauties start with Judy’s Magic Cast On, cruise through a shaped gusset and turned heel, and finish with a lined cuff built with Lola’s Two-Timing Technique. The Toe Up Larch Peds are clever, comfy, and built for repeat knitting. Whether you’re strolling through town or lounging at home, they’ve got just the right amount of cush. Plus, they’re short.

Original Larch Peds
Larch Peds are short socks that know exactly what they are—not long. With a ribbed cuff lining for function and flair, they’re ideal for hikes, lounging, or dancing around the living room. Worked top down with a snug fit, padded cuff, and clever heel shaping. These socks were part of the March '24 Lola’s Choice kit (and yes, they sold out fast). Bonus: there's a nearly hour-long video tutorial to walk you through it all. And they’re the perfect amount of short.

Larch Slippers
Cozy, squishy, and secretly sophisticated—Larch Slippers are the DK-weight cousin of the Larch Peds, built for lounging in style. With a smooth princess sole, lined cuff, and clever arch shaping, they’re as comfy as any slipper could be. The no-fuss heel flap uses Lola’s Pick Up Line (flirting optional), and the whole pattern is packed with details for a snug, secure fit. Sized for the whole family, so no one gets slipper envy. Plus—you guessed it—they’re short.

Bottoms Up
Bottoms Up are shortie socks with a wild streak. Worked toe-up with a brioche toe and a heel that blends corrugated ribbing and brioche like it’s no big deal, these socks are built for comfort and style. The top finishes off with a playful pop of beaded flair—because your ankles deserve to party too. Feeling spicy? Try the full version. More chill? Go with the simplified take. Both are included because options are fun. Designed for a main skein + mini combo, these socks are your excuse to dig into that sock stash. And yes. These babies are short.

Princess Lola
Delicate feet deserve deluxe treatment—enter Princess Lola. These toe-up socks feature a silky-smooth princess sole (knit side in!), a decorative gusset, and a slipped-stitch heel tough enough for royal errands. The cuff? A short-row crown topped with twinkly beads, because Lola wouldn’t have it any other way. Bonus: you’ll look this regal with less than 250 yards of yarn. Fancy feet, functional fit, and a video to guide your way. Long live the short sock.

Lemme Peds
Lemme just say—these short socks are a whole vibe. Lemme Peds are worked top-down with the swirly, sparkly Lemme Stitch and a pop of beads at the ankle; they’re equal parts glam and comfy. A classic eye-of-partridge heel and smooth princess sole bring the structure, while subtle ribbing keeps the fit just right. Fast to knit. Fun to wear. Flawlessly short.

Nugget Peds
Small skein? No problem. Nugget Peds are quick-knit shorties that start at the top with a sparkly beaded cuff—just like the Nugget Mitts! They’re knit top-down with a classic heel and smooth fit, perfect for sock newbies or seasoned pros looking for a fast finish. Beads are optional. Fun is not. Short is also optional and fun!
